Effluent Splitters for Gas Chromatography

Abstract
The construction of two effluent splitters for gas chromatographs (GC) and a method for collecting and transferring GC fractions are described. These effluent splitters provide an efficient, simple, and inexpensive method for obtaining samples from a GC on the micro- and submicrogram scale. The use of these splitters and the collecting and transferring techniques are exemplified with trimethytsilyl derivatives of mono- and disaccharides. Mass spectra and melting points are obtained for these collected derivatives. The effluent splitters described here are applicable to virtually any substance which can be separated by gas chromatography.
